2015-05-18 3 views
0

Как добавить дочернее значение, когда мы проверили родительский элемент? Как передать значение флажка в javascript?Как создать древовидный вид с помощью angularjs и json?

+0

Как @Madhu сказал, что вы пробовали? Здесь, в Stack Overflow, мы хотим помочь, но мы не хотим делать это за вас. Пожалуйста, предоставьте код, который вы уже * пробовали *. Подробнее о задании вопросов читайте в [справочном центре] (https://www.stackoverflow.com/help/). – Jeffrey

+0

Я создал древовидное представление, но я не могу добавить дочернее значение из текстового поля. –

+0

var app = angular.module ('app', []); Функция sampleController ($ scope) { \t $ scope.товар = [ \t { \t \t текст: "пункт А", \t \t детей: \t \t [ \t \t \t { \t \t \t \t \t текст: "пункт А-1", \t \t \t \t \t дети: \t \t \t \t[ \t \t \t \t \t \t {текст: "Пункт А-1-1"}, \t \t \t \t \t \t {текст: "Пункт А-1-2"} \t \t \t \t \t] \t \t \t}, \t \t \t \t {текст: "пункт А-2"}, \t \t \t {текст: "Пункт А-3"} \t \t] \t}, \t { \t \t текст: "пункт Б", \t \t детей: \t \t [ \t \t \t {текст:» пункт Б-1 "}, \t \t \t {текст:" пункт Б-2" }, \t \t \t \t \t { \t \t \t \t \t текст: "Пункт Б-3", \t \t \t \t \t детей: \t \t \t \t \t [ \t \t \t \t \t \t {текст: "Пункт Б-3-1" }, \t \t \t \t \t {текст: "item B-3-2"} \t \t \t \t \t] \t \t \t}, \t \t \t \t {текст: "Пункт В-4"}, \t \t \t {текст: "Пункт Б-5"} \t \t] \t} \t]; \t } –

ответ

0

Я не знаю код, который вы написали, дайте мне знать код.

Возможно, вам необходимо создать одно действие и вызвать его, когда вы установили флажок, и это действие вытесняет объекты в объекты $ scope.items, или вы можете использовать карту в javascript для более быстрой работы при извлечении.

Смежные вопросы